From the designer:
The owners of a Mid century Home in The Auckland suburb of Castor Bay with its ocean views and palm tree lined gardens needing an overhaul contacted us to re invent their interiors and add some classic glam to the homes bathrooms and living areas.
The master ensuite, wardrobe and bedroom was on the top of the wish-list to be reinvented.
The original space had one small standard wardrobe which the owners had no room and no storage, creating the need to use the seperate bedroom adjacent for His wardrobe overflow.
Plus, the original ensuite was every shade of beige and peach, feeling bland and without personality.
The homeowners wanted a little bit of glam and a nod to the Mid century feel of the home.
The owners’ love their collection of 50s/60s era furniture and the new spaces needed to be sympathetic to these and to feel like it belonged in the home while also feeling contemporary and fresh.
The owners also love splashes of bright colour but wanted to be able to add these in furnishing and art – so the palette for the renovation scheme we created with a mix of rich brass and bronze metallics, stone and pattern creates an overall theme for the home.
From the master bedroom with its earthy soft tones feeling tranquil and stepping through the walk-through wardrobe of His and Hers sides with accents of bronze panels leads to their new ensuite.
The space for the ensuite was made larger by rearranging the family bathroom and pushing a wall out.
This allowed space for the walk though wardrobes and large double vanity and shower with His and hers at opposite ends.
Reeded glass, deep bronze vanity cabinets and a bold pattern metallic wallpaper add the Mid century feel and a lux vibe.
Feature lights backlighting floor to ceiling mirrors and the wall to wall recess in shower add a luxury feel, highlighting the multiple patterns and textures of the space.
